100 Miles, 100 Years. Public record launch event. A stolen overcoat, a murdered thief. People in 19th-century Pittsburgh made mistakes. Sometimes those bad decisions are all we know of them. Public Record: Pittsburgh is a series of hauntings; ghostly recollections of people lost to history but for their sole transgressive act.
